Output 8f6bf5329e2ec9ac3384733161bdaa5806215088d79a9c04cfc7ed7514454220:0

value
200000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b6c116f36d20b02b97e01580aa137ecc3c4ad92d OP_EQUALVERIFY OP_CHECKSIG
address
1HfKJ21NA7YhYGeH1BFjDxABHudNR53UPa
transaction
8f6bf5329e2ec9ac3384733161bdaa5806215088d79a9c04cfc7ed7514454220
confirmations
530023
spent
true